Anna Bulbrook’s GIRLSCHOOL
GIRLSCHOOL is a music festival that celebrates women-identified-fronted bands and women artists. After spending a decade as a “sideman” in the alternative rock world, where you really don’t see a lot of other women around—onstage or on your crew—I started to really miss and crave the camaraderie of women.

Beckie Campbell – Versatility and Passion
Beckie Campbell is the owner of B4MediaProduction, a growing production company, supplying anything from small corporate set-ups and medium to large concert system set-ups. Being versatile, Beckie also works as an independent contractor to several companies around the US. Erin Barra – Educator, Songwriter, Producer, Music Technology Consultant
Erin Barra has a wide ranging skill set educator, songwriter, producer, multi-instrumentalist, and music technology consultant. Erin specializes in music technology integration, she works with artists/bands looking to integrate laptops and digital technologies into their writing, production and stage setups.
